619 healthcare providers across 20 specialties

Cromwell, Connecticut appears in the CMS National Plan and Provider Enumeration System with 619 registered healthcare providers spanning 20 distinct NUCC-taxonomy specialties. This count includes every individual clinician who has applied for an NPI and listed a practice address in Cromwell — physicians, dentists, nurse practitioners, physician assistants, chiropractors, physical therapists, optometrists, psychologists, podiatrists, and every other credentialed provider type CMS tracks. It does not measure hospital beds, urgent-care capacity, or whether a given clinic is accepting new patients; it measures the pool of professionals with current NPI enrollment and a Cromwell practice location on file.

The provider mix in Cromwell is weighted toward Developmental Therapist (172 clinicians, followed by Behavior Analyst with 77 and Occupational Therapist with 64). That distribution reflects how NPPES records specialty: providers self-select a primary taxonomy code, so a family physician who also practices geriatrics will show up under whichever NUCC code they registered first.
